
Game Overview
Civil War battles unfold as tense, smoke-choked command problems rather than tidy strategy puzzles, asking you to direct formations across fields, ridges, woods, and roads where a bad order can unravel an entire line. Scourge Of War – Remastered is a real-time command simulation built around the brutal rhythm of black-powder warfare: infantry march in formation, artillery needs good ground and clear fields of fire, cavalry screens flanks, and morale can matter as much as raw numbers. Its tone is methodical and severe, favoring historical pressure over arcade spectacle. Battles feel less like commanding individual soldiers and more like trying to keep an army functioning while information, time, and ammunition run short.
Players issue orders to brigades, divisions, and other formations on fully 3D terrain, then watch commanders and units carry them out amid the confusion of live combat. There are no turn-based grids or dice-roll pauses dictating every decision; movement, volleys, reinforcements, and retreats occur continuously, although the action can be paused when a battlefield crisis needs careful planning. The central loop revolves around reading terrain, forming effective battle lines, coordinating attacks, protecting artillery, and reacting when units lose cohesion or enemy troops appear on an exposed flank. Historical scenarios let you revisit major clashes from the regiment-based warfare era, while the capable AI provides a demanding opponent that understands the value of position and pressure.
What separates it from many Civil War strategy games is its commitment to chain-of-command friction and battlefield scale. Orders are not magic clicks that instantly rearrange every regiment, so success comes from anticipation, sound deployment, and accepting that even a strong plan can go wrong once musket fire starts. The remastered presentation makes the classic command-focused design easier to approach without diluting its old-school wargame priorities. Fans of Sid Meier’s Gettysburg!, Take Command: 2nd Manassas, or the slower tactical side of Total War find plenty to appreciate, while newcomers should be ready for a learning curve that rewards patience and historical curiosity.
